On Sun, 25 Oct 1998, Eray Plamay wrote:
>Situation: I cannot get minicom nor xminicom to dial out. But as soon as
>I close the prg it tries to dial the number. Seyon, however does dial
>out so I'm really confused. Why would one prg dial but not the other.
>Also I tried "echo "AT7373737/n" >/dev/cua1" per the book but nothing
>happens at all. No dial-tone nothing.

Did you check the permiossions on /dev/cua1?  It should have world
read/write permissions. Then make the link from /dev/modem to /dev/cua1. You
can do it manually or with the modem config tool in X11.
